Our client is currently seeking skilled and experienced Plant Operators for a contract-based role in Oswestry. The primary responsibility will be the process monitoring of the new plant during the commissioning phase.


Key Responsibilities:

  • Monitor and assess the process operating parameters on a daily basis, including:
  • MLSS (Mixed Liquor Suspended Solids)
  • SSVI (Sludge Volume Index)
  • Final effluent analyses
  • Sludge thickener performance
  • Sludge and chemicals
  • Regularly monitor plant equipment, including:
  • Ferric and caustic chemical systems
  • Sludge thickeners
  • Maintain and monitor analysers, recalibrate instruments, and order reagents as required.
  • Adjust process parameters to ensure optimal performance.
  • Report directly to the Advance Plus process commissioning engineer.
  • Work closely with the commissioning team to ensure smooth project progression and completion.
  • Attend regular meetings to discuss progress, performance, and any related issues.
  • Complete daily logs and record all operational data.
  • Order necessary chemicals (ferric, caustic, poly, reagents, cuvettes for sampling analyses) and take deliveries.
  • Assist the team with shutdowns, access requirements, and other related tasks during the commissioning phase.

About The Candidate:
The ideal candidate will have a strong background as a skilled and experienced plant operator, with a comprehensive understanding of the day-to-day operational needs of a water treatment plant and the ability to respond to any issues that arise during the commissioning phase.
